sql语句占位符的用法 mysql的占位符标记

导读:
使用占位符标记是一种安全的方式来执行MySQL查询 。这种方法可以防止SQL注入攻击,同时也提高了代码的可读性和可维护性 。本文将介绍什么是占位符标记以及如何在MySQL中使用它们 。
1. 什么是占位符标记?
占位符标记是一种在SQL语句中使用变量的方法 。它们用于代替SQL语句中的实际值 , 并在执行查询时被替换为实际值 。占位符标记通常用于预处理语句,这是一种减少重复代码的技术 , 也可以提高查询性能 。
2. 如何在MySQL中使用占位符标记?
在MySQL中使用占位符标记需要使用预处理语句 。预处理语句包括两个步骤:准备和执行 。在准备阶段,我们使用“PREPARE”语句创建一个预处理语句对象,并指定占位符标记的数量和类型 。在执行阶段,我们使用“EXECUTE”语句执行预处理语句,并将占位符标记替换为实际值 。
3. 占位符标记的优点是什么?
使用占位符标记可以防止SQL注入攻击,因为占位符标记不会被解释为SQL语句的一部分 。此外,占位符标记可以提高代码的可读性和可维护性 , 因为它们使SQL查询更易于理解和修改 。
总结:
【sql语句占位符的用法 mysql的占位符标记】占位符标记是一种在MySQL中使用变量的方法 。它们用于代替SQL语句中的实际值,并在执行查询时被替换为实际值 。使用占位符标记可以防止SQL注入攻击,提高代码的可读性和可维护性 。在MySQL中使用占位符标记需要使用预处理语句,包括准备和执行两个步骤 。

    推荐阅读